Description

A beautifully refurbished and modernised two-bedroom apartment is presented in the iconic Westminster Gardens, an Art Deco landmark with lifts, parking and a 24-hour concierge.

Situated on the fifth floor, this luxury apartment has been meticulously upgraded to fuse classic charm with modern opulence. It boasts a principal bedroom with custom built wardrobes and a marble en-suite bathroom, plus a second suite with a dressing room and Philippe Starck shower. Ideal for hosting, it features a spacious reception area, a state-of-the-art audio-visual system, and a gourmet kitchen with Smallbone cabinetry and Miele appliances.

Additional perks include a 24-hour concierge, residents' parking, and a rooftop terrace offering stunning views.

Located in central Westminster, it's steps away from historic sites and fashionable hubs, with excellent transport links at Victoria, St James' Park, Pimlico, and Westminster underground stations.

Jackson-Stops was founded by Herbert Jackson-Stops in 1910. Since then, the business has grown from a single office in Towcester Town Hall to over forty offices in London, Surrey and across the country.
